12. Experiencing a Spiritual Awakening as a Result of These Steps, We Endeavored to Share this Message with Alcoholics and Addicts and to Apply the Principles in All Our Endeavors
“The key point is our willingness to grow spiritually.” (page 60). This could serve as our mission statement.
The twelfth step might act as our purpose statement. It comprises three elements: 1) Experiencing a spiritual awakening due to these steps, 2) we endeavored to share this message with alcoholics, and 3) to apply these principles in all of our endeavors.
Achieving purpose #1 happens when we follow steps 1-11 exactly as outlined in the book from “The Doctor’s Opinion” (8 pages) to “Into Action” (88 pages). Details for achieving purpose #2 are found in Chapter 7, “Working with Others” (15 pages). Consequently, the strategy for purpose #3 — applying these principles in all parts of our lives — must reside in the final four chapters (60 pages).
Too often, we hear individuals claim they have completed all the steps, yet they haven't sponsored a single person. We also hear the twelfth step referred to as service, yet sponsorship remains unmentioned. Observing their actions, they seldom apply the principles in every aspect of their lives.
Simply reviewing the page count dedicated to each step shows that the twelfth step spans 75 of the 172 pages of the book's recovery section, or 41%. Completing steps 1-11 means we've achieved only 59% of the goal, and even sponsoring one person brings us only to 65% of the program's purpose. Thus, applying the principles in all aspects of our lives is essential for truly becoming whole again.
From my experience, it wasn't until I began sponsoring others and fully grasped what it means to genuinely apply the principles in my home, work, and other areas that I found a fulfilling life with the potential for lasting recovery. Once I committed to applying the principles in all aspects of my life, spiritual growth naturally followed.
